Lightmatter builds chips for artificial intelligence infrastructure that leverage the unique properties of light for efficient interconnect and computing. As the Director of Product Management and Marketing for Optics/Photonics, you will be responsible for leading our product definition, rollout, and marketing to drive design wins with the industry's top semiconductor and cloud vendors for our photonics-enabled solutions.
Reporting directly to the VP of Product, you will work with engineering, sales, operations, finance, and the executive team to accelerate the adoption of Lightmatter products in segment-defining categories.
Responsibilities
Complete the detailed requirements definition (MRD/PRD), product line family/SKU strategy, and commercial market positioning for the company’s silicon photonics-based hardware offerings with a focus on Passage, Lightmatter’s programmable photonic chiplet interconnect. This also includes evaluation/development systems and other demonstration vehicles.
Drive industry partner relationships and the availability of partner hardware solution offerings including lasers, fibers, connectors, and other related optical components.
Manage the roll-out of the products to lead customers and product lifecycle management through the development process all the way to and through the production phases
Along with sales, pursue and win key customers by producing collaterals and articulating key advantages and value propositions of Lightmatter products through detailed customer proposals
Develop pricing guidelines, margin analysis, and forecasts establishing competitiveness and profitability of Lightmatter products in support of corporate financial goals and revenue planning
Represent Lightmatter at key industry forums and speaking events as a corporate leader and subject matter expert
Develop high-quality, high-value outbound marketing and product technical collaterals in conjunction with product marketing and technical documentation teams
Brief top industry press, analysts, and investors relative to Lightmatter product strategies, competitive advantages, and other industry trends.
